Pros

They work very hard to vet potential contractors to work virtually as admins, assistants, bookkeepers, etc. When they've chosen you as a contractor for their repertoire, congratulations, because you're someone they see as valuable and bringing something to the table. They offer great flexibility to those who need a stay at home work environment. They put a lot of effort into placing clients and contractors based on a multitude of factors, and it really helps make work enjoyable for everyone involved.

Cons

Multi-stage interview process. It was about 6 weeks from application to hire. It can take weeks to get placed with a client. The pay is decent, but not necessarily comparative with all markets.

Pros

Belay does a good job of connecting clients with VA's and offering support as the engagement begins. If you have never worked as a VA this is a great way to learn the ropes.

Cons

Once the engagement is well on it's way Belay continues to take a significant portion of the monthly stipend but the VA is working independently. There are minimal opportunities for salary raises and pay caps keep contract earnings significantly under what you can earn as a true independent contractor, which is how you file your taxes. 1099.
